Partnerships with insulin pumps

The Libre 3 Plus sensor is authorised to work with the mylife Loop automated insulin delivery system, including mylife CAM APS® FX app and mylife YpsoPump insulin pump. For use of the Libre 3 Plus sensor with the mylife Loop, refer to the labeling provided with the mylife CamAPS FX app.

Indicated for ages 2+^

The Libre 3 Plus sensor is indicated for patients 2 years and older.^

LibreView

Glucose data can be uploaded from patients’ Libre 3 readers to LibreView

LibreView, our secure6 cloud-based system, allows patients to share their glucose data with Healthcare Professionals. When connected, you will be able to access more in-depth reports to support you in making treatment decisions for your patients.
